Questões de Concurso Comentadas sobre metodologia de desenvolvimento de software em engenharia de software

Foram encontradas 239 questões

Q2128025 Engenharia de Software
Na Engenharia de Software, um modelo de processo é uma representação simplificada que permite definir e observar as atividades do desenvolvimento de um programa. Sobre esses modelos de processo, considere as seguintes afirmações:

I- Abordagem na qual um grande número de componentes, previamente disponíveis, são integrados.
II- Abordagem na qual as atividades fundamentais dos processos são representadas como fases distintas e bem definidas.
III- Abordagem na qual as atividades dos processos são intercaladas de modo que o programa é uma série de versões, cada uma com mais funcionalidades que a anterior.

Assinale a alternativa que traz a CORRETA associação entre os modelos de processo com suas respectivas definições. 
Alternativas
Q2128024 Engenharia de Software
A Engenharia de Software possui como principal objetivo apoiar o desenvolvimento profissional de soluções, a partir do emprego de técnicas que auxiliam na especificação, projeto e evolução dos programas. Acerca desse assunto, avalie as asserções a seguir:
Os engenheiros de software precisam adotar uma abordagem sistemática e organizada para o exercício de suas atividades.
PORQUE

Para os engenheiros de software, a escolha da abordagem determina a eficácia e a eficiência na produção de software de alta qualidade na maioria dos casos.

Acerca dessas asserções, assinale a alternativa CORRETA.
Alternativas
Q2119588 Engenharia de Software
Metodologias de desenvolvimento de software chamadas de ágeis são baseadas em desenvolvimento iterativo, no qual requisitos e soluções evoluem pela colaboração entre equipes auto-organizadas e cross-funcional (pessoas com diferentes expertises). Essas metodologias encorajam frequente inspeção e adaptação, alinhamento entre o desenvolvimento e os objetivos dos clientes e um conjunto de boas práticas que permita entregas rápidas e de qualidade. Considerando as metodologias ágeis de desenvolvimento de software, assinale a alternativa INCORRETA.
Alternativas
Q2084762 Engenharia de Software
s princípios das atividades metodológicas têm forte influência sobre o sucesso de cada atividade metodológica genérica definida como parte do processo de software. Selecione o princípio de atividade metodológica que abrange um conjunto de tarefas de codificação e testes que gera um software operacional pronto para ser entregue ao cliente e ao usuário.
Alternativas
Ano: 2023 Banca: FEPESE Órgão: EPAGRI Prova: FEPESE - 2023 - EPAGRI - Analista de Sistemas |
Q2074274 Engenharia de Software
Assinale a alternativa que apresenta somente metodologias tradicionais de desenvolvimento de software.
Alternativas
Ano: 2023 Banca: FEPESE Órgão: EPAGRI Prova: FEPESE - 2023 - EPAGRI - Analista de Sistemas |
Q2074272 Engenharia de Software
Qual metodologia de desenvolvimento de software é orientado a missões, tendo cada interação justificada por uma missão, priorizando os itens de alto risco?
Alternativas
Ano: 2023 Banca: FEPESE Órgão: EPAGRI Prova: FEPESE - 2023 - EPAGRI - Analista de Sistemas |
Q2074271 Engenharia de Software
Para dizermos que estamos utilizando por completo uma Metodologia X de desenvolvimento de software, devemos seguir à risca as suas diretrizes.
Qual metodologia preza que cada funcionalidade de um software tenha um teste automatizado implementado, antes de ser codificado?
Alternativas
Ano: 2023 Banca: FEPESE Órgão: EPAGRI Prova: FEPESE - 2023 - EPAGRI - Analista de Sistemas |
Q2074270 Engenharia de Software
Qual metodologia tem foco em gestão de pessoas, talentos e comunicação e que caracteriza o tamanho de suas equipes em yellow, orange e red?
Alternativas
Ano: 2023 Banca: FEPESE Órgão: EPAGRI Prova: FEPESE - 2023 - EPAGRI - Analista de Sistemas |
Q2074268 Engenharia de Software
Em uma equipe de 15 pessoas, trabalhando em um projeto utilizando da metodologia DSDM (Dynamic Systems Development Methodology), sem acúmulos de papéis entre eles, o componente que é responsável por garantir o projeto do ponto de vista empresarial, devendo conhecer todos os objetivos do negócio, recebe o nome de:
Alternativas
Ano: 2023 Banca: FEPESE Órgão: EPAGRI Prova: FEPESE - 2023 - EPAGRI - Analista de Sistemas |
Q2074267 Engenharia de Software
A metodologia DSDM (Dynamic Systems Development Methodology) possui alguns conceitos particulares, entre eles aquele que prevê a priorização dos requisitos.
Assinale a alternativa que indica corretamente o nome da técnica utilizada.
Alternativas
Q2071945 Engenharia de Software

A respeito do desenvolvimento e da manutenção de sistemas e aplicações, julgue o item. 


O cliente não deve ser envolvido em nenhuma fase do desenvolvimento de um sistema, uma vez que ele pode confundir os analistas de sistemas com suas declarações.

Alternativas
Q2071943 Engenharia de Software

A respeito do desenvolvimento e da manutenção de sistemas e aplicações, julgue o item. 


Para a obtenção de um sistema com alta qualidade, é fundamental haver a compreensão do problema, a identificação dos requisitos do software e sua especificação detalhada.

Alternativas
Q2294533 Engenharia de Software
Na Engenharia de Software existem várias metodologias de desenvolvimento tais como:

(1) Metodologia Ativa. (2) Scrum. (3) Desenvolvimento Ágil. (4) Modelo Cascata.

Da relação apresentada, somente são aplicadas:
Alternativas
Q2104677 Engenharia de Software
O método de tradução das linguagens de programação é um aspecto importante a se considerar em projetos de software. Considerando que a forma pela qual o código em linguagem de alto nível é convertido para linguagem de máquina pode ser determinante para a escolha da linguagem, assinale a afirmativa correta. 
Alternativas
Q2073421 Engenharia de Software
Acerca dos métodos ágeis, analise as assertivas e assinale a alternativa que aponta a(s) correta(s).
I. Os métodos ágeis foram desenvolvidos para serem utilizados por pequenos times de desenvolvedores. II. Empresas pequenas, que não tinham processos formais, foram os primeiros entusiastas dos métodos ágeis. III. Uma das vantagens do desenvolvimento ágil é que ele pode ser utilizado para qualquer tipo de desenvolvimento de software. 
Alternativas
Q1984251 Engenharia de Software
Você foi contratado para liderar uma equipe de DevOps. Um dos objetivos da sua liderança é aumentar a velocidade das entregas e a qualidade de novos recursos das aplicações utilizando o desenvolvimento orientado a testes.
Assinale a opção que apresenta a ordem que descreve o ciclo de desenvolvimento orientado a testes.
Alternativas
Q1966428 Engenharia de Software
A respeito dos modelos de tripla e quádrupla hélice para um sistema de inovação, julgue o item seguinte. 

Na visão da hélice quádrupla, para a elaboração de estratégias políticas de conhecimento e inovação, deve-se valer do sistema midiático para influenciar a cultura e os valores públicos. 
Alternativas
Q1966427 Engenharia de Software
A respeito dos modelos de tripla e quádrupla hélice para um sistema de inovação, julgue o item seguinte. 

O modelo de quatro hélices difere dos modelos anteriores a ele na medida em que tem como foco a consideração do impacto do meio ambiente natural no ecossistema de inovação. 
Alternativas
Q1966421 Engenharia de Software
Julgue o item a seguir, em relação a NPS (Net Promoter Score) e métricas de UXD (User Experience Design). 

A dimensão descritiva das métricas de UX mostra ao analista o que aconteceu em relação aos produtos digitais da organização.
Alternativas
Q1966415 Engenharia de Software
Determinada equipe de produção textual foi avaliada quanto à sua produtividade de entrega, no período de quatro semanas, num contexto de gerenciamento ágil. Verificou-se que, na primeira semana, a equipe entregou 4 histórias; na segunda semana, entregou 6 histórias; na terceira semana, entregou outras 6 histórias; e na quarta semana, entregou 4 histórias. A média de produtividade foi de 5 histórias e o desvio padrão foi 1.

Com base na situação hipotética apresentada, julgue o item que se segue. 

O delivery rate de todo o período avaliado é igual a 1.
Alternativas
Respostas
41: D
42: A
43: A
44: D
45: E
46: E
47: A
48: C
49: A
50: B
51: E
52: C
53: C
54: C
55: D
56: D
57: C
58: E
59: C
60: E